Seneca Falls, N.Y. – Gerald Frederick, from Waterloo, was arrested early Saturday morning and taken to the Seneca County Correctional Facility. 

Seneca Falls Police say Frederick is accused of having sexual contact with a 15-year-old female on three separate occasions. 

Frederick is facing three counts of forcible touching, as well as endangering the welfare of a child, according to police. 

Police say an order of protection was issued for the female victim. 

Frederick will appear in the town of Seneca Falls court later in November.
